It is declared that the state public welfare demands and the state public policy requires that a state facility be built and a state program be established that can teach and assist individuals who are blind to adjust to and become a useful part of society; that in addition to existing facilities and vocational and rehabilitation programs for individuals who are blind in Mississippi, an Adjustment Center for Individuals who are Blind is needed to assist those persons in adopting attitudes, behavior patterns, and otherwise becoming acclimated for a full, more useful and productive life.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Mississippi Code Title 43. Public Welfare § 43-3-3 -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ms/title-43-public-welfare/ms-code-sect-43-3-3/
